      • 균류 분화과정의 유전적 조절기작

        박범찬,이환희,박윤희,박희문 충남대학교 생물공학연구소 2003 생물공학연구지 Vol.9 No.1

        Fungi are well suited for studying mechanism controlling development and cell differentiation in multicellular eukaryotes. The asexual and sexual reproductive cycles are tightly coordinated during the life cycle of Aspergillus nidulans. The asexual (mitotic) reproductive cycle involves the formation of a number of differentiated cell types. Successful formation of multicellular reproductive structures and spores (conidia) requires the establishment of spatiotemporal gradients in essential transcriptional regulators, such as brlA, abaA and wetA. Altered gene expression is coordinated with critical changes in the movement of nuclei and the regulation of the cell division cycle. Therefore, it has been proposed to define a central regulatory pathway. Several early regulatory genes involved in signal transduction pathway controlling asexual sporulation are also required for activating the central pathway. Sexual (meiotic) reproduction is more complex, requiring the differentiation of several specialized tissue types. Although technical difficulties have limited efforts to study the genetics of sexual fruiting-body formation directly, some recent progress has been made. With the recent availability of mutants blocked in sexual development, understanding the genetic interactions between genes that function primarily in determining sexual sporulation will be achieved in the near future.

        Transmission ability of Zika virus with artificially infected Aedes albopictus in Korea

        Yang Sung‐Chan,Lee Hee-Il,Kim Hyunwoo,Lee Wook‐Gyo 한국곤충학회 2021 Entomological Research Vol.51 No.8

        Zika virus (ZIKV), a virus mainly occurring in South America, is now globally distributed. Understanding the pathogen transmission cycle in a vector is exceptionally important in developing disease control strategies. In this study, we performed ZIKV microinjection in Aedes albopictus (Skuese), to estimate its vertical and horizontal transmission ability. The virus infection rate was confirmed by real-time qPCR in the F1 generation derived from the ZIKV-injected Ae. albopictus. The minimum infection rate (MIR) of the F1 generation was highest when they were injected with the virus at 6–12 h (MIR: 16.1) and lowest at 12–24 h (MIR: 4.7) after feeding. In the developmental stage of the F1 progeny, MIR values were 1.0, 1.3, and 6.7 in each egg, larval, and adult stage, respectively, but ZIKV was not detected in the pupa stage. Virus transmission ability was not significantly different between the collection areas (Tongyeong and Jeju). Ae. albopictus demonstrated a high venereal transmission rate of ZIKV and was detected in males (6 pool/7 pool) and females (6 pool/7 pool), confirming that ZIKV can be transmitted from infected mosquitoes to uninfected mosquitoes via mating. This is the first study of the administration of a ZIKV microinjection to Ae. albopictus in Korea and suggests a possibility of a potential mechanism for the virus to survive during adverse conditions via vertical transmission.

      • 프리미돈의 한국인에서의 생체이용율시험

        권광일,윤민혁,윤희열,박희찬,권준택,심희옥,김동출 충남대학교 약학대학 의약품개발연구소 2004 藥學論文集 Vol.19 No.-

        A reversed phase HPLC method was developed and validated for the determination of primidone in human plasma. Propylthiouracil was used as an internal standard. Calibration curves were linear in the concentration range of 10-120 ng/㎖. The coefficient of variation of the intra- and inter-day precision were below 15%. The coefficient of variation of the accuracy were below 15% in the concentration range investigated. A bioavailability study was performed using the validated HPLC method. Twenty four healthy human male volunteers were orally administered 20 mg of primidone. The pharmacokinetic parameters were calculated using WinNonlin. The mean values of AUC_(LAST) was 85.0±17.7 ㎍ hr/㎖, C_(max) was 4.22±1.04 ㎍/㎖, T_(max) was 1.85±1.13 hr, t_(1/2) was 17.7±2.4 hr. The pharmacokinetic parameters and the HPLC method can be used for the desigm of bioequivalence study of primidone.

        전시를 위한 토기와 청자의 복원 : 토기기대, 노형기대, 청자사이호를 중심으로

        강희숙,안병찬 국립중앙박물관 1999 박물관보존과학 Vol.1 No.-

        국립김해박물관 개관전시 유물인 가야시대 土器 器臺 2점과 중앙박물관의 특별전 “고대국가의 형성” 전시회 출품 유물인 靑磁四耳壺에 대한 보존처리를 수행하였다. 육안 및 실체현미경 관찰을 통하여 처리 전 상태, 文樣과 製作技法 등을 파악하였고 이를 토대로 각 유물의 특성에 맞는 보존처리를 실시하였다. 기대는 결실부분이 커 에폭시系 복원재료를 이용해 파손된 토기 面과 직접 접착시켜 형태를 복원하고 문양과 색, 질감을 類似하게 처리하였다. 청자는 토기와 같은 복원재를 이용했지만 파손된 청자 면과 分離시켜 형태를 복원하여 해체가 가능하도록 조치한 다음 색과 질감도 구분이 되도록 처리하였다. Conservation treatment was done for the pottery-stand of Gaya period which was to be exhibited in celebration of the opening of Gimhae National Museum and for the jar of Chinese celadon which was to be exhibited in Korea National Museums special exhibition "Formation of Ancient States". Through the examinations by naked eyes and under the microscope, condition before treatment, patterns and manufacturing techniques of the objects were observed. According to these examinations, conservation treatments, suitable for each object was finished. As the pottery-stand was damaged severely, the epoxy resin was pasted directly on the broken surface of the pottery to restore the original shape and pattern, color and feeling similar to original state were given to the restored area. Although same restoration material was applied on the celadon, it was not pasted directly on the broken surface of the celadon so that the restored area could be dismantled, and color and feeling were also treated somewhat differently.

        정신지체특수학교 직업교육 혁신을 위한 교사참조요목 개발

        박희찬,정민호 국립특수교육원 2005 특수교육연구 Vol.12 No.1

        이 연구는 정신지체특수학교의 직업교육을 혁신하기 위해 교사참조요목을 개발하는데 목적이 있다. 이를 위하여 제7차 특수학교 교육과정의 하나인 기본교육과정의 직업교육, 전환교육, 그리고 지원고용 관련 문헌을 분석하여 교사참조요목의 초안을 마련하였고, 6명으로 구성된 직업교육 전문가 집단의 검토를 거쳐 5개영역에서 44개 문항을 개발하였다. 이 문항의 중요성에 대하여 중등부가 있는 전국 정신지체 특수학교 직업교사를 대상으로 조사연구를 실시하였다. 조사연구는 교사참조요목의 각 항목에 대한 중요성을 5점 척도의 조사지 형태로 만들어 실시하였고, 71개 학교에서 조사지가 회수되었다. 전체 조사문항에 대한 신뢰도로 Cronbach α는 .95였다. 조사결과, 교사참조요목의 교육과정은 모두 6개의 항목으로 구성되었고, 평정 점수는 4.18~4.41, 평균 점수는 4.34이었다. 교육방법은 16개의 항목에 평정점수는 3.90~4.65, 평균점수는 4.26이었다. 교육인력은 11개의 항목에 평정점수는 3.92~4.73, 평균점수는 4.31이었다. 교육시설은 6개의 항목에 평정점수 4.39~4.62, 평균점수 4.51이었다. 교육지원은 5개의 항목에 평정점수는 4.49~4.76, 평균점수 4.61이었다. 마지막으로 교사참조요목에 대한 논의와 활용 방안 개발, 현장 특수학교에서의 적용 사례 제시 등 후속연구 방안이 제안되었다. The purpose of the study was the development of teachers' reference inventory for renovation of vocational education of special schools for students with mental retardation. To investigate the purpose, the study reviewed Vocational Education Teachers' Book in 7th Basic Curriculum and literatures related to transition as well as supported employment. As a teachers' inventory, 44 items were developed in five areas based on the literature review and professionals discussion. Then, the importance of the 44 items were evaluated using 1 to 5 Likert scale by vocational special education teachers in 71 special schools among 73 special schools for students with mental retardation. The Cronbach's αof the inventory was .95. The first area, vocational education curriculum was composed of 6 items and evaluated from 4.18 to 4.41, with mean of 4.34. The second area, vocational educational method was composed of 16 items and evaluated from 3.90 to 4.65, with mean of 4.26. The third area, vocational educational personnel was composed of 11 items and evaluated from 3.92 to 4.73, with mean of 4.31. The fourth area, vocational educational facility was composed of 6 items and evaluated from 4.39 to 4.62, with mean of 4.51. Finally, the educational support for vocational education area was composed of 5 items and evaluated from 4.49 to 4.76, with mean of 4.61. The study suggested further research on the application method of the teachers' inventory and effective uses of the inventory in special schools to renovate vocational education.

      • 심전도 모니터링 계측 시스템의 개발에 관한 연구

        박찬원,전찬민,박희석 강원대학교 정보통신연구소 2004 정보통신논문지 Vol.8 No.-

        A wearable electrodiagram(ECG) monitoring system is a widely used non-invasive diagnostic tool for ambulatory patients who may be at risk from latent life-threatening cardiac abnormalities. In this paper. we have a portable ECG monitoring system with conductive fiber characterized by the small-size and the low power consumption. The system consists of conductive fibers, one-chip microcontroller, ECG preprocessing circuit, and monitoring software to record and analyze in PC. ECG preprocessing circuit is made of pre-amplifier with gain of 10, band-pass filter with bandwidth of 0.5-120% and 2.5V offset circuit for A/D conversion. ECG signals obtained by sensor are corrupted by noises such as a baseline wandering, 60Hz power noise and interference noise by body movement. For cancellation of noises in signals obtained by conductive fiber, we used the wavelet decomposition of wavelet transforms in MATLAB toolbox.

        가옥 및 실험실내 라돈평형인자, 비 흡착 라돈자손 비율의 일일 변동 특성

        이승찬,김창규,이동명,강희동 대한방사선 방어학회 2001 방사선방어학회지 Vol.26 No.4

        일반가옥 및 실험실에서 라돈농도, 평형등가농도 및 평형인자의 농도 변화를 검토하였으며, 환기조건에 따른 평형인자, 비흡착 라돈자손 비율의 변동 특성을 검토하였다. 가옥 7개 지점에서의 평균 라돈농도, 평형등가농도 및 평형인자는 각각 30 Bq m^-3, 19.6 Bq m^-3 0.65였다. 한편, 실험실 3개 지점에서의 평균 라돈농도, 평형등가농도 및 평형인자는 55.0 Bq m^-3, 31.9 Bq m^-3 , 0.58였다. 실내에서의 라돈농도, 평형등가농도 및 평형인자는 새벽 및 아침시간에 높고 오후 4시부터 밤 10시 사이에 낮아지는 주기적인 특성을 나타내었다. 환기상태가 좋은 경우가 환기상태가 나쁜 경우에 비해 평형인자는 낮아지는 반면, 비 흡착 라돈자손 비율이 증가하는 경향을 나타내었으며, 평형인자는 기압, 습도에 비례하는 반면, 온도에는 반비례하는 관계를 나타내었다. The variation characteristics of radon concentration, equilibrium equivalent concentration and equilibrium factor in some houses and laboratory buildings have been studied. The variation of equilibrium factor and the unattached fraction of radon progeny with ventilation condition have been also estimated. The averages of radon concentration, equilibrium equivalent concentration and equilibrium factor were 30 Bq m^-3, 19.6 Bq m^-3 and 0.65 in seven houses, while 55.0 Bq m^-3, 31.9 Bq m^-3 and 0.58 in three laboratory buildings, respectively. The diurnal variation of radon concentration, equilibrium equivalent concentration and equilibrium factor in indoor showed a typical pattern that the radon concentration, equilibrium equivalent concentration and equilibrium factor increased at dawn and morning, while decreased at midday and evening. While the equilibrium factor rate deceased in the indoor environment which was well ventilated, the unattached fraction of radon progeny increased. The equilibrium factor was in proportion to air pressure and humidity of indoor, whereas in inverse proportion to temperature.

      • Bipolar-mode Static Induced Transistor(SIT) 소자 설계에 관한 연구

        손상희,김홍배,박찬석,곽계달 청주대학교 산업과학연구소 1993 産業科學硏究 Vol.11 No.-

        BSIT is simulated in two-dimensional and simulation results are compared with those of experimental device. To get the accurate design data of BSIT, device operation, carrier dynamics depending on channel impurity concentration and current flows depending on gate depth are examined through two-dimensional numerical simulation. Also, conductivity modulation effect in saturation-mode is analyzed from the distribution of minority carrier and electric field. Through the above procedure, the design procedure of SIT will be more effective.
